drm/amdgpu: fix PSP autoload twice in FLR

Assigning false to block->status.hw overwrites PSP's previous
hardware status, which causes the PSP to Resume operation after
hardware init.

Remove this assignment and let the PSP execute Resume operation
when it is told to.
